Columbia starts as a democracy,stuck with the liberals for many years and the immigrants you get are few,and your culture is only in venezuela and ecuador,who are both strong.What are some good tips for forming Grand Columbia and dominating south america later on?

Assuming you mean Colombia (Columbia is in Canada (edit: dukeofmunster beat me to it)): If you can beat Venezuela in an early war, you can deprive them of a common border with the UK. But be careful - your soldier pops are small, so if you suffer too many casualties it may take very long to replenish them. When you find yourself in a war (particularly against Brazil) use the terrain to your advantage. Wait for the enemy armies to die of attrition in the jungles and then lure them into defensive battles in favourable terrain (with reinforcements at the ready). If Columbia is successful it will get immigrants, don't worry about that.
 
For Colombia the main risk is that you are sphered by a GP before becoming a GP yourself, which normally makes it difficult to keep a balanced budget and is likely to result in the loss of Panama to that GP, which you can't form Gran Colombia without. One tactic to use if you are is to make the state of Panama independent just before being placed in a GP's sphere, as a delaying tactic.
You need to become a GP before about 1865 - preferably late 1850s - and the only way I have been able to do it is prestige, as Colombia can't afford an enormous army or navy and industry will be insignificant for a while. So you should first research the first two aesthetics techs, then the first tech that increases your research points. After that, commerce and industry techs will probably be needed to keep on top of your budget. You should always research prestige-improving culture techs as soon as they become available, prioritizing aesthetics in particular. This may mean not researching anything for brief periods in order to dive in as soon as these research techs become available.
At the beginning maintain good relations with Brazil, who has a core in Amazonas. When these relations are sufficient declare war to make your neighbors your puppets, adding the 'humiliate' goal for prestige.
You only need Ecuador and Venezuela to form Gran Colombia, but it's fun to try and get most of Latin America puppeted. Start with smaller less powerful states and finish with Argentina and Brazil. If Brazil is allied with a GP decrease relations so that they declare war for Amazonas.
If up to it you may be able to move on to Mexico or even the CSA. I've never been able to do this but the best tactic is to wait until the US has diminished most of their brigades before declaring war.
Once Gran Colombia is formed you will finally be financially viable, but it is unlikely that you will ever have a planned economy or state capitalism unless you use national focus to encourage these parties actively.
 
A quick way for territory is to 1st stomp Haiti, its a small island, rarely has friends and is not in a sphere. Then turn onto the Central Americans. Force them to release one nation and they will fall apart as each province is a different country. With Haiti and some parts of Central America either free, allied, or conquered you have expanded your country. Don't worry about your culture, it will slowly spread. As USCA I conquered Panama and turned it Central American in 10 years. A good way to gain power then is to stomp Ecuador. Between Venezuela and Ecuador, the ladder is definitely the easier one. It is only two regions and is quite easy to defeat. The galapagos islands also make a nice step for colonization in the Pacific. With the small empire you now have you may not have friends. Not to worry! If Cuba has gained independence by now, which it often does for me, you can conquer or puppet it as it makes another "free" island and one that is quite close to america. Well now you can invade Venezuela. Good luck
 
Do you inherit all the nations you puppet?So if i puppet all south american nations do i get to annex them after forming grand columbia?
 
Do you inherit all the nations you puppet?So if i puppet all South American nations do i get to annex them after forming grand columbia?

Yes. Ecuador and Venezuela need to be either sphered or puppeted; any other nations need to be puppeted. I think any nation can be a puppet - I've only done it with Latin American countries, but you could probably do it with countries on other continents.
 
Columbia starts as a democracy,stuck with the liberals for many years and the immigrants you get are few,and your culture is only in venezuela and ecuador,who are both strong.What are some good tips for forming Grand Columbia and dominating south america later on?

1. The party you have to start with can be remedied almost immediately. Simply call for an election on day one of the game. The conservatives will win. If you want the reactionaries instead, you'll need to use NF and stop making clergy. Not recommended.

2. Columbia and Venezuela can be beaten if you do not disband the 18000 man army you start with. Venezuela also starts with an 18000 man army but they wil disband them except for one brigade. So your primary enemy will be their allies, which can be brazil. Micromanage. A lot.

3. I'm assuming your goal is to form gran colombia. Ideally, you should puppet venezuela and ecuador and take territories from other countries. This is the most efficient allocation of your infamy points (do not waste infamy taking land from ecuador and venezuela).

4. Your number one biggest threat is a french sphered brazil. I have been unable to solve this problem. Let me know if you do.
